Hospital acoustics — why vital?

Hospital noise has medically proven adverse effects:

  • ICU patient recovery is extended
  • Staff focus is split, error risk rises
  • Alarm sounds create stress and sleep disturbance
  • Patient satisfaction drops

The WHO "Hospital Noise Limits" report recommends below 30-35 dBA in hospital spaces.

Hospital space types

  • Intensive Care Unit (ICU): the most critical, target 30-35 dBA
  • MR / CT room: magnetically compatible materials, 60 dB Rw
  • Operating theatre: sterilisation + acoustics together
  • Patient room: Rw 50+ dB, antibacterial surfaces
  • A&E: high activity, sound control needed
  • Waiting area: reverberation control, RT60 0.6-0.8 s
  • Doctor's office: privacy (Rw 42+ dB)
  • Corridor: acoustic ceiling and carpet

MR room special acoustics

MR machines produce 95-110 dB while operating. Both transmission to outside and disturbance to the patient must be prevented. MR rooms require non-magnetic materials; standard steel structures disrupt the magnetic field. Custom-made products are used.

Antibacterial and low-VOC

Hospital acoustic materials carry special certifications:

  • Antibacterial surface (ISO 22196)
  • Low VOC emissions (Greenguard)
  • Cleanable / disinfectable
  • Fire resistance (EN 13501-1 A2)

Target performance

  • Patient room indoor: 30-35 dBA
  • ICU ambient: under 30 dBA
  • Partition wall Rw: 50+ dB
  • Patient-room door Rw: 35+ dB
  • Corridor RT60: 0.6-0.8 s
